Output 6599a61ea0cf6843f50320bfc7c30edc10d2ef3b4aff5765367175cd1bd52257:1

value
312018
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e68625fc35ca2d9bff3485c861d904aa13c3df31a346a44ee2d1cef1cdee5c2
address
bc1p3e5xyh7rtj3dn0lnfpwgv8vsf2snc00nrg6x538w95ww78x7uhpqqg0vvs
transaction
6599a61ea0cf6843f50320bfc7c30edc10d2ef3b4aff5765367175cd1bd52257
spent
true